英文原题

  1. A triangular piece of paper of area 1 is folded along a line parallel to one of the sidesand pressed flat. What is the minimum possible area of the resulting figure?
解析

英文解析

  1. A triangular piece of paper of area 1 is folded along a line parallel to one of the sidesand pressed flat. What is the minimum possible area of the resulting figure?
    Solution: 2/3
    Let the triangle be denoted ABC , and suppose we fold parallel to BC . Let the distancefrom A to BC be h , and suppose we fold along a line at a distance of ch from A .
